Webpage disappears after a few seconds under certain browser width

more options

Hi, I'm an eng trying to do cross-browser debugging. Firefox is giving me a weird bug. To start:

- No plugins installed - No ad blockers installed - Cleared cache, cookies, history, everything - version 58.0.2 (64-bit) on Mac OS 10.12.6

Having trouble repro'ing this bug but here's my best shot.

Navigate to https://www.joinhonor.com/care-network

Shrink the browser width to about 500px.

Scroll a bit, wait a bit. Maybe do something else for a few seconds.

Page goes blank except for header, footer and maybe a few other components.

Doesn't happen in Chrome or Safari.

I've been able to repro on a few pages but not consistently.

Any ideas? Thanks!

The problem occurs when the display is narrow enough for the photo in the top section to move below the yellow button.

Any time I change something in the Page Inspector, e.g., click off display:flex for a div or assign display:block to a span, everything is good for 5-10 seconds, and then away it goes. There is a constantly running script that is doing something odd, but I have no idea what it is.

This page is very complex. You probably should seek support on a site where experts on this framework hang out.

This framework is waaaaay too complicated for me to find anything. What I can tell you with certainty is: if JavaScript is disabled, the problem goes away.

There are other issues with scripts disabled, such as the quote carousel overlaying body text. I wonder if the carousel could be an issue? It would make sense to be something running on a timer.
